'68 1300 single port, Solex 30 PICT 2 carb. Vacuum only dizzy with Pertronix.

Checked timing, valves and plugs.

Drives fine, idles fine.

BUT the motor just dies when coming off the gas at junctions. Not every time though.

Is this likely to be a carb issue? Idle mixture setting?

I experienced that problem when coming to a stop at an intersection. What I found was there were two issues. One was I didn't have the timing set exactly right, which adjusting that helped but didn't completely solve it. The other was my 009 distributor. When I replaced it with a Pertronix SVDA distributor with solid state ignition the problem was resolved.

On the 009 dist, there are two 009 styles; the older style and the later one which seems to be better (the cases are visually different). They're advance comes in earlier than other distributers like the sedan's do but spinning it will tell you what is going on advance wise. I think there are some adjustments that can be made.

Have the dist. put on a spinning machine which well tell you if the bearing/bushings are OK and the advance is working and not hanging up. My dist. is updated to the Pertronix innards also which did help.

I have been told that the 010 (a later dist.) can be updated and run w/o the vacuum advance.

Also have the carb(s) checked for float level and the innards working/adjusted correctly (the float for example).

It is always the more "sneaky things" that often cause the problems so don't just stick with the obvious things.
